I don't think you can take earnings to compare skill level between two players. Of course MC is a very good and accomplished player but in terms of skill i would always favor MVP because he won the GSL Code S twice as much as MC and was in twice as much finals. He won pretty much every foreign tourneys he entered in...it's a pretty accurate mesurement of skill level, if you win 70% of the tournament you entered in you're probably better than the guy who only win 60% even if the guy won 15 tournaments and you "only" won 8 or 9 (with a good sample size tho, if you only entered 1 and won it, i won't say you are better than the guy who won 15 and entered 20). You can earn quite a lot of money winning a foreign tourney without even having so much trouble because your opponents aren't as good as in the GSL and no foreign tourney come close to the overall skill level of GSL Code S.

I have to say, that you are being massively picky and actually flat out wrong. Complaining at the number that he used? He tried to post all of the great achievements that MVP has, i want to know how many there are, not whether it is a nice round number.

As for saying that Nestea was the first to win back to back GSL titles. You are wrong again. The super tournament took place between May and July. The super tournament is considered a GSL. Even if you wanted to talk about Code S tournaments (which isn't what the writer said), to criticise him on it seems entirely unwarranted.

As for what you are saying about MLG, he states what is most impressive is the fact that winning an MLG is for MVP unimpressive.

Not knowing what the gainward tournament is isn't the writer's failing, it is yours. Don't criticise him on it. I didn't know what it was either, and now i do i could look it up if i wanted.


As for who is the second most successful player, sure, there is an argument to be made for it not being Nestea, and MC seems a good choice, but GSLs are considered the crowning achievement of a SC2 player, so it is absolutely fair for him to use Nestea who has the second largest number of titles, as well as being the first to make it to 3 if i recall correctly.
